#=============================================================================# # Author: QueezyTheGreat # # Date: 26.04.2011 # # # # Description: Arduino CMake example # # # #=============================================================================# set(CMAKE_MODULE_PATH ${CMAKE_SOURCE_DIR}/cmake/modules) # CMake module search path set(CMAKE_TOOLCHAIN_FILE ${CMAKE_SOURCE_DIR}/cmake/toolchains/Arduino.cmake) # Arduino Toolchain set(ARDUINO_LINKER_FLAGS "-lc -lm") set(ARDUINO_SDK_PATH ${CMAKE_SOURCE_DIR}/../arduino-1.0) cmake_minimum_required(VERSION 2.8) #====================================================================# # Setup Project # #====================================================================# project(Drehimpusgebertest) find_package(Arduino 1.0 REQUIRED) set(FIRMWARE_NAME LIFE) set(${FIRMWARE_NAME}_SRCS drehimp.cpp) set(${FIRMWARE_NAME}_BOARD atmega168) set(${FIRMWARE_NAME}_LIBS m ) set(${FIRMWARE_NAME}_PORT /dev/ttyUSB0) generate_arduino_firmware(${FIRMWARE_NAME})